SpaceXAI has announced Grok 4.6, a new AI model with a 500K context window designed for extended knowledge and coding tasks. Key details on availability, performance, and pricing are still pending.
SpaceXAI has announced Grok 4.6, a new AI model that features a 500,000-token context window and is optimized for long-running agents, coding, and knowledge work. The company has not disclosed details regarding its availability, pricing, or performance benchmarks, but the announcement underscores its focus on extending AI capabilities for complex, sustained tasks.
The announcement describes Grok 4.6 as a frontier model, a term used by xAI to indicate its advanced technical scope, though it is not a formally recognized classification. The core claim is that the model can process a 500K context window, enabling it to handle large datasets, extensive codebases, or lengthy document collections within a single session. This capacity aims to support use cases involving multi-step research, software development, and knowledge management, where maintaining contextual awareness over extended periods is critical.
However, the available information does not specify whether the full context window is accessible across all product tiers or only in select developer environments. Nor does it include independent testing, benchmark results, or safety evaluations. The announcement also omits details about deployment scope, API limits, regional availability, and pricing structures, leaving many practical questions unanswered for potential users.

Background on Long-Context AI Development
Over recent years, AI providers have progressively increased context window sizes to improve the handling of large datasets and complex tasks. Prior models typically supported between 8,000 and 32,000 tokens, with some experimental systems reaching up to 100,000 tokens. The claim of a 500K context window by Grok 4.6 represents a substantial leap, positioning it among the most capable models for extended, multi-step workflows. Nonetheless, the industry has yet to see independent validation of such claims, and the relationship between context size and reliable performance remains an open question.
